1 - 3 of 3 Listings
Rent
All
Serial Number: 20210856
Location: Decatur, Illinois, USA
Seller: Herc Rentals
Serial Number: 20221167
Location: West Valley City, Utah, USA
Seller: Herc Rentals
Serial Number: 20221168
Location: West Valley City, Utah, USA
Seller: Herc Rentals